Comaradrie, colour and Friendship was the theme for the ladies Thursday morning aggregated stableford  fixture.  Friendship Day is an important fixture in the golfing calendar.  It was introduced to encourage ladies to have a game with those they wouldn’t normally play with.  It is a popular day where the colour yellow dominates around the course […]

Mount Lawley’s Azer Pehlic & Kirsten Rudgeley take out the 2019 Amateur Championships of Western Australian played at Wanneroo Golf Club over the weekend.
